@Minusator

Как присвоить класс тегу body?

Данный код добавляет по клику на элемент класс .stories-slider-in
document.querySelectorAll(".demo-stories a").forEach((t, e) => {
    t.addEventListener("click", s => {
        s.preventDefault(), q.classList.add("stories-slider-in"), K.enable(), K.slideTo(e, 0);
       
    })
});


Как добавить тегу body класс .name и убрать его когда нет класса .stories-slider-in?

Благодарю за помошь!
  • Вопрос задан
  • 114 просмотров
Решения вопроса 1
Stalker_RED
@Stalker_RED
// определяем есть ли элемент с классом .stories-slider-in
const hasSlider = !!document.querySelector('.stories-slider-in');
// переключаем .name в зависимости от hasSlider
document.body.classList.toggle('name', hasSlider);
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
20 нояб. 2024, в 21:10
10000 руб./за проект
20 нояб. 2024, в 20:55
40000 руб./за проект
20 нояб. 2024, в 20:26
2400 руб./за проект